R588 HWR is a 1997 Ford Ka in Silver with a 1,299c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.

Across all 1997 Ford Ka models, the average MOT pass rate is 60.7% with a typical mileage of 64,290 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Ford Ka f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 404,005 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R588 HWR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Ka typ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 29 years old, this Ford Ka is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
